**To customize an imported dashboard:**
To customize the imported dashboard, we recommend that you save it under a different name.
If you don't, upgrading Grafana can overwrite the customized dashboard with the new version.
## Use test data to report issues
If you report an issue on GitHub involving the use or rendering of time series data, we strongly recommend that you use this data source to replicate the issue.
That makes it much easier for the developers to replicate and solve your issue.
